There are a few obvious trends in the stories that dominated (and continue to dominate as the awards roll in) the 2014 cinematic season. Sociopaths had a big year (Gone Girl, Nightcrawler), as did women who walked really far (Tracks, Wild) and people who found healing through music (Rudderless, Begin Again, Frank).
